ALBUQUERQUE, N.M. (KRQE) – Around 8 p.m. Thursday, July 28, Bernalillo County Sheriff’s Office deputies responded to a gas station at Coors and Gun Club for a shots-fired call. Officials say when deputies arrived on scene they found a man dead who had suffered from at least one gunshot wound.
Witnesses said two men were in an altercation in the parking lot when shots were fired. BCSO says they believe the offenders fled in a blue 2005 Dodge Ram 1500 with the license plate AFAX64. They say the truck is also reported as stolen. Anyone with information on the incident is asked to contact BCSO Detective Carroll at (505) 263-5617 or ViolentCrimes@bernco.gov.
